consanguineous

Syllabification: (con·san·guin·e·ous)
Definition of consanguineous

adjective

  • relating to or denoting people descended from the same ancestor:consanguineous marriages

Derivatives

consanguinity

Pronunciation: /-ˈgwinitē/
noun

Origin:

early 17th century: from Latin consanguineus 'of the same blood' (from con- 'together' + sanguis 'blood') + -ous
